Bernardo Silva will leave Manchester City this summer after nine years at the club. acques Feeney/Offside/Offside via Getty Images - Bernardo Silva's agent, Jorge Mendes, has offered the out-of-contract midfielder to Real Madrid as a prepares to leave Manchester City this summer, reports AS. Silva is not in Madrid's plans as it stands, and he has also been offered to their arch rivals Barcelona. The 31-year-old has been a fixture of City's team this season as he bids to win his seventh Premier League title in nine years.
